ODS Layer: Fundamentos para Data Warehouses Modernos
Aprenda os princípios de design para uma camada ODS

ODS Layer: Fundamentos para Data Warehouses Modernos
20 de março de 2026
Com a crescente complexidade dos dados e a necessidade de análises mais rápidas, a camada ODS (Operational Data Store) tornou-se um componente crucial na arquitetura de data warehouses modernos. Uma ODS bem projetada garante a qualidade, rastreabilidade e confiabilidade dos dados, servindo como base sólida para análises avançadas e tomadas de decisão estratégicas.
A Importância Estratégica da Camada ODS
A camada ODS atua como o primeiro ponto de contato dos dados provenientes de sistemas operacionais. Sua principal função é receber os dados em sua forma bruta, realizar uma padronização básica e preservar o nível máximo de detalhe. Diferentemente de um data mart ou data warehouse, a ODS não se destina a análises complexas, mas sim a fornecer uma base de dados estável e confiável para as camadas subsequentes.
Estratégias de Ingestão de Dados: Escolhendo a Abordagem Certa
A escolha da estratégia de ingestão de dados é fundamental para o desempenho e a escalabilidade da ODS. As três abordagens mais comuns são a extração completa, a extração incremental e a captura de dados de alteração (CDC).
Extração Completa: Simplicidade com Limitações
A extração completa envolve a leitura e o carregamento de toda a tabela a cada execução. Embora simples de implementar, essa abordagem pode ser ineficiente para grandes volumes de dados, devido ao alto custo computacional e de armazenamento. É mais adequada para tabelas pequenas, com baixa frequência de atualização, ou para cargas iniciais.
Extração Incremental: Eficiência com Resalvas
A extração incremental sincroniza apenas os dados alterados, com base em campos como data de atualização ou ID incremental. Essa abordagem é mais eficiente do que a extração completa, mas requer um cuidado redobrado com a confiabilidade dos campos de incremento, que podem ser afetados por backfills ou inconsistências de tempo. Mecanismos de gerenciamento de watermark e janelas de lookback são essenciais para garantir a consistência dos dados.
CDC: Capturando Alterações em Tempo Real
A captura de dados de alteração (CDC) monitora os logs de banco de dados para identificar e replicar as alterações em tempo real. Essa abordagem oferece a menor latência e a maior precisão, mas também é a mais complexa de implementar, exigindo um conhecimento profundo dos logs de banco de dados e dos mecanismos de replicação.
Quer otimizar a ingestão de dados na sua ODS?
Solicite uma demonstração da Toolzz AIParticionamento e Gerenciamento do Ciclo de Vida para Otimização de Custos
O particionamento adequado e o gerenciamento do ciclo de vida dos dados são cruciais para otimizar o desempenho e os custos da ODS. O particionamento por tempo é a prática mais comum, permitindo consultas mais rápidas e o arquivamento eficiente de dados históricos.
Idempotência, Deduplicação e Gerenciamento de Dados Atrasados
A idempotência, a deduplicação e o gerenciamento de dados atrasados são aspectos críticos para garantir a qualidade e a confiabilidade da ODS. A idempotência garante que a execução repetida de uma tarefa não gere dados duplicados. A deduplicação elimina registros duplicados, garantindo a integridade dos dados. O gerenciamento de dados atrasados lida com registros que chegam fora de ordem ou com atraso, garantindo que todos os dados sejam processados corretamente.
Está buscando garantir a qualidade dos seus dados? Descubra como a Toolzz AI pode te ajudar a automatizar a validação e limpeza dos dados na sua ODS.
Modelagem Histórica: Escolhendo a Abordagem Ideal
Ao lidar com dados históricos, é importante escolher a abordagem de modelagem mais adequada. As opções incluem snapshots, SCD2 (Slowly Changing Dimension Type 2) e logs de alterações. Cada abordagem tem suas vantagens e desvantagens, e a escolha depende dos requisitos específicos de cada caso de uso.
Automatizando a Qualidade de Dados com a Toolzz
A implementação de uma camada ODS robusta e confiável pode ser complexa, exigindo um planejamento cuidadoso e a escolha das ferramentas certas. A Toolzz oferece soluções de IA que podem automatizar muitos dos processos envolvidos na ingestão, transformação e qualidade dos dados, acelerando a entrega de valor e reduzindo os custos operacionais. Com a Toolzz AI, você pode criar agentes de IA personalizados para monitorar a qualidade dos dados, identificar anomalias e automatizar a correção de erros, garantindo que sua ODS esteja sempre em perfeitas condições.
Veja como é fácil criar sua IA
Clique na seta abaixo para começar uma demonstração interativa de como criar sua própria IA.















